Hardin-Simmons University

Hardin-Simmons University is an institution of higher learning located in Abilene, Texas. Founded in 1891, it is historically known as one of the oldest universities in the state of Texas. The university offers an array of programs, spanning different disciplines such as education, business, sciences, and the humanities. With over 30 academic programs, students can choose courses that meet their interests and career goals. The school is affiliated with the Baptist General Convention of Texas and encourages a Christian lifestyle based on biblical principles. Student services, such as access to libraries, counseling centers, and the Health Services Center, are available to help the students succeed. Cost

Tuition and Fees $31,364
Books and Supplies $800
Room & Board $9,740
Other $3,176
Total Cost $45,080

Admissions

  • Acceptance Rate: 91%
  • SAT Range: 960 – 1150
  • ACT Range: 18 – 24
